Emotional labour is still labour.

Some women are carrying entire households emotionally while pretending they are “fine.”
Women are often expected to manage emotions, maintain harmony, absorb tension, lead gently, nurture teams, and still perform professionally.

They manage invisible workload, burnout, emotional leadership fatigue, and workplace imbalance.

Sustainable leaders understand rhythm. They know that lasting impact depends on more than ambition or constant output. It requires awareness of:
• personal capacity and energy levels;
• rest and recovery cycles;
• emotional pacing and self-regulation;
• the difference between urgency and sustainability; and
• the kind of long-term impact that can be built without burnout.
